The Sustainable Construction Talks are a Saint-Gobain initiative that has been held in several countries, fostering the exchange of knowledge, experiences, and best practices around sustainability and construction. These spaces have been essential for bringing together key stakeholders and building local agendas aligned with global commitments to decarbonization and sustainability.
